Sofa Table Q 2. Produce an orthographic drawing of the Sofa Table shown in the drawing provided at a scale of 1: 5. Include eight dimensions. (5%) Q 3. Produce an Isometric drawing of the Sofa Table shown in the drawing provided at a scale of 1: 5. Do not dimension. (5%) Specifications: The Top has 70 mm cross banding all around with an ellipse size Major 500 mm, Minor 260 mm centred on the table. The ellipse is divided in 30° segments. The bottom rail is 20 mm x 20 mm and is flush with legs. The Top has a 15 mm round moulding all around. J. Byrne 2015 3

Draw isometric box overall size of Table 1040 mm x 500 mm at the correct scale J. Byrne 2015 7
Divide quadrant into equal lines Divide quarter of circle into 5 mm spaces Divide quarter of ellipse into 5 mm spaces J. Byrne 2015 8
Repeat steps on isometric Number each division and take measurements from plan and mark off on isometric J. Byrne 2015 9
Complete drawing Draw in leg frame taking all measurements from elevation and end view J. Byrne 2015 10
